Quality Monitoring for Surface Treatment from Plasmatreat
In the age of Industry 4.0, process safety and reproducibility requirements are constantly increasing. In the automotive and electronics sectors, for example, or in medical technology, securing production steps and the traceability of those steps are important parts of documentation. Plasmatreat GmbH, a leader in atmospheric plasma technology from Steinhagen, Germany, supports digitized manufacturing with its Plasma Control Unit (PCU) and makes numerous controls, regulation and monitoring functions available to ensure consistently high surface-treatment quality and reproducibility.
One of the big challenges in surface treatment with plasma is that it must not leave visible traces on the substrate. How is the result of the treatment evaluated? Auxiliary parameters such as purely inspecting the plasma beam’s color are not, according to Plasmatreat, sufficient for comprehensively evaluating treatment quality.
